Ways To Reduce Noise From Gripper Chains In Operation

Gripper are widely used in various industries, including manufacturing, packaging, and logistics. However, when in operation, the can create a lot of noise, which can be annoying and potentially harmful to workers' health. In this article, we will discuss some ways to reduce noise from gripper chains in operation.

1. Choose the Right Chain Material

One of the most important factors that determine the noise level of gripper chains is the material used to make them. Different materials have different vibration and noise-dampening properties. For example, plastic chains tend to be quieter than metal chains because they absorb vibrations better. Therefore, it is important to choose the right chain material based on your application's specific needs.

2. Lubricate the Chains Regularly

Gripper chains that are not lubricated properly can create more noise when in operation. Therefore, it is important to lubricate the chains regularly to reduce friction and noise. You can use a lubricant that is specifically designed for gripper chains to ensure that it is effective.

3. Adjust the Tension of the Chains

If the gripper chains are too loose or too tight, they can create more noise and wear out faster. Therefore, it is important to adjust the tension of the chains to ensure that they are within the manufacturer's recommended range. This can also help to reduce vibration and noise.

4. Install Noise-Dampening Pads or Covers

Noise-dampening pads or covers can be installed on the gripper chains to absorb vibrations and reduce noise. These can be made of various materials, such as rubber or foam, and can be customized to fit your specific chain size and shape.

5. Upgrade to a Quieter Chain Design

If your gripper chains are old or outdated, it may be worth considering upgrading to a newer, quieter chain design. There are many new chain designs on the market that are designed to be quieter and more efficient than older designs.

Gripper Chains Q&A

Q: How often should I lubricate my gripper chains?

A: It is recommended to lubricate your gripper chains at least once a month or whenever you notice increased noise or wear.

Q: Can noise-dampening pads be used on any type of gripper chain?

A: Yes, noise-dampening pads can be customized to fit any type of gripper chain, regardless of size or shape.

Q: How do I know if my gripper chains need to be replaced?

A: You should inspect your gripper chains regularly for signs of wear, such as elongation or damage to the links or pins. If you notice any significant wear, it may be time to replace your chains.
